With recent soaring temperatures you may be surprised to learn Colorado has an outdoor ice rink where you can skate or ride bumper cars. Idaho Springs’ Frozen Fire Rink is the coolest place to play hockey, practice your skating tricks or slide and bump your way to fun all while surrounded by our Rocky Mountains. Mile High Spirits
Mile High Spirits opened in 2011 in the heart of Denver’s River North (RiNo) art’s district before moving to downtown’s Ballpark neighborhood in 2014. MHS is Denver’s OG urban distillery in the Mile High City, crafting grain to bottle spirits for a fair price.

Photo courtesy: Mile High Spirits
They offer Bourbon, Whiskey, Vodka, Gin, Tequila, Rum and canned Moscow Mule/Punching Mule at their tasting room bar and in 16 states coast to coast.
When you visit Mile High Spirits you will experience live music — from Bluegrass to DJ mixes — and unique homemade cocktails. All of their spirits are made in house by their expert distilling team.
That’s not all- they have a variety of interesting activities while you take in cocktails and music: magic cornhole boards, photo booths, table ring toss and more.
